Quick answers
What are the chances of seeing a Bay-breasted Warbler in Farallones de Cali National Natural Park?
About 1% of visitor-days record a Bay-breasted Warbler sighting in Farallones de Cali National Natural Park, based on 82 observer-days of citizen-science data from GBIF.
When is the best time to see Bay-breasted Warbler in Farallones de Cali National Natural Park?
December has the highest sighting rate for Bay-breasted Warbler in Farallones de Cali National Natural Park in our monthly data.
